Guayas Province: Reforesta Guayas
Reforesta Guayas is an initiative aimed at reversing the effects of deforestation and improving the quality of life of the population through the planting of native trees. With a participatory and inclusive approach, the program has successfully planted over 235,500 trees in the province since 2023, involving communities, farmers, private companies, and local governments in the process. Its strategy combines urban greening, productive systems, and ecosystem restoration to ensure a positive and sustainable environmental impact. In addition, the installation of forest nurseries in strategic points across the province will help achieve the goal of planting 506,000 native trees by 2027. The Guayas Prefecture reaffirms its commitment to environmental protection and ecological transition through this transformative and participatory project.
